UK Full Sovereign Gold Coin Elizabeth II 2016-2021
The most recent portrait of Queen Elizabeth II appeared on Bullion Sovereigns in 2016. This portrait is the fifth portrait to appear on Sovereigns during her reign. The modern British sovereigns feature Benedetto Pistrucci's design depicting George & the Dragon on the reverse. They have been struck both at the Royal Mint and at branch mints since 1817. - Each coin weighs 7.98g and is 916.7 22ct Gold. - Dimensions: Diameter: 22.05mm Thickness: 1.52mm. Other Information The fifth portrait was designed by Jody Clark, who aged 33, is the youngest artist to have achieved this honour. The fifth portrait did appear on Sovereign coins in 2015, but only in proof edition. This was the first time in over 100 years that two different busts appeared on a sovereign in a single year. In 2017 UK Sovereigns featured a unique shield mark. This privy mark featured to celebrate the 200th Anniversary of the modern Sovereign. Above the shield the number 200 can be seen.
